原创 H5調用手機的前後攝像頭,canvas顯示,自帶截圖,兼容ios和android

注意 1.下面的HTML需要在HTTPS下訪問方可正常工作,對應的localhost或者本地地址訪問不能支持; 2. facingMode: { exact: 'environment' } // -- 後置 facingMode

原创 vue2+webpack3+中引入ts-loader後編譯性能大幅較低,TypeScript構建優化處理

如果你嘗試過在webpack3+引入ts-loader使用過DllReferencePlugin、awesome-typescript-loader、ParallelUglifyPlugin、thread-loader/happy

原创 EINTEGRITY:npm 5.0完整性檢查和modernizr.com依賴關係

EINTEGRITY:npm 5.0完整性檢查和modernizr.com依賴關係 安裝軟件包時遇到此錯誤: D:\flow_heart>npm install npm ERR! code EINTEGRITY npm ERR!

原创 angular input file的ngchange方法不生效

1.第一種使用onchange來想辦法覆蓋原方法(推薦,適合頁面上有多個地方上傳圖片,方法只用寫一個) angular input file ngchange方法不生效,可以使用onchange來想辦法覆蓋原方法 οnchang

原创 常用正則統計

校驗數字 數字:^[0-9]*$ 、 /^[0-9.]{0,30}$/ n位的數字:^\d{n}$ 至少n位的數字:^\d{n,}$ m-n位的數字:^\d{m,n}$ 兩位小數:/(^[0-9](\d+)?(\.\d{1,2}

原创 iOS拍照顯示不正確的問題

只需記住: 1.iOS拍照默認的照片方向並不是豎着拿手機時的情況,而是橫向,即Home鍵在右側; 2.android拍照默認的照片方向並不是豎着拿手機的; 3.主要是獲取圖片的EXIF頭部信息,其中有一個叫做Orientation

原创 如何處理pc端的字體大小的適配問題(完美解決)

export const resetPc = () => { var wH = window.innerHeight; // 當前窗口的高度 var wW = window.innerWidth; // 當前窗口的寬度

原创 關於請求狀態400的問題

**400 一眼看去的確是前端提交的JSON數據格式存在問題(80%左右的概率都是前端),但是有種是後端的(不管是Java,還是Node,如果沒有按照他們的要求傳遞JSON格式(你不知道的格式情況下20%的概率都是後端的),也會報錯)

原创 node.js作爲請求中轉,解決前端頁面——node.js服務——後臺服務(Java、PHP)數據交互問題

重寫對應的get、put、post、delete請求; var express = require('express'); var publicMethod = express.Router(); var http = require

原创 Git Permission Denied

前幾天把自己的Ubuntu系統升級了一下,結果Git連不上GitHub了,其中各種心酸啊,主要是誤信了官方文檔關於測試SSH連接成功那部分的提示,不多說直接上乾貨 1、本地配置Git用戶名和郵箱名 $ git config --glo

原创 css animation實現圖片切換效果

<!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<meta na

原创 pkg 項目打包成可執行文件

目錄結構 index.js引入config.json config = JSON.parse(fs.readFileSync('./config/config.json')); visti_port = config.vist

原创 vue 項目node服務器部署流程

vue 項目npm run build 進行打包部署,在打包之前進行config下配置文件index.js的修改,將assetsPublicPath:'/' 修改成 assetsPublicPath: './', 服務器上進行exp

原创 mac中的brew安裝失敗

如果對應的Xcode安裝後執行官網命令報錯 /usr/bin/ruby -e "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/master/insta

原创 HTML5 圖片本地壓縮上傳插件「localResizeIMG」

移動應用中用戶往往需要上傳照片,但是用戶上傳的照片尺寸通常很大,而手機的流量卻很有限,所以在上傳前對圖像進行壓縮是很有必要的。 原生應用可以直接對文件進行處理,網頁應用就沒有這個優勢了。不過 canvas 的出現給出一條新的思